Locally, Deutz is to merge the various operational functions at its Cologne and Ulm sites into a single unit at each location, with responsibility for quality, delivery, reliability and costs.

Internationally, Deutz’s three sales regions, service operations and back office sales management functions will be merged to form one global entity. Marketing, corporate development, quality management and product management are to be fused into a new corporate management function.

The changes will result in the number of executives reporting to the management board reduced from 25 to 17. The management board itself was reduced from four members to three in March, as part of Deutz’s MOVE action programme.

“This organisational realignment will enable us not only to reduce the number of executives who report directly to the management board but also to put in place more efficient structures based on swifter decision-making processes and a flatter hierarchy,” said Margarete Haase, who has responsibility for finance and human resources on the Deutz management board.

“This will make us quicker and more effective.”
